Description
Almost every component of the Supertech R Vented Boot, Alpinestars definitive racing boot as worn by a roster of champions past and present, has undergone a rigorous program of upgrades to sharpen its performance features even further. Featuring extensive perforations throughout for maximum airflow, innovations derived using feedback from Alpinestars involvement in top flight racing include a newly redesigned front flex area, a redesigned rear bellow, a redesigned top gaitor, a new shifter and shin plate, a new shin slider and a new inner bootie, all of which enhance the comfort, protection and the performance of this boot to a new class-leading high.
Features:
- New TPU shin plate has been redesigned for greater impact absorption performance, thus improving abrasion resistance in a key area
- New replaceable shin slider for additional abrasion resistance
- New TPU stretch panel design with zip for an easier entry and exit and a closer, more optimized fit
- Hook and loop closure secures the puller zip remains in position
- Micro adjustable ratchet closure on top of boot for an optimized fit
- Main upper material constructed using microfiber with a dedicated laser perforation zone for optimum breathability and abrasion resistance, while also delivering high levels of flexibility
- New front flex area for improved impact abrasion while also ensuring the natural front and back
- New front flex area increases ventilation and airflow for additional breathability
- Redesigned rear bellow in stretch microfiber for improved natural front and back movement
- Redesigned top gaiter in microfiber material with TPU over injection for enhanced prehensility
Construction:
- Sole constructed using a lightweight rubber compound for excellent grip on the pegs
- Separate, internally updated bio-mechanical inner bootie made by 3D mesh material for greater structure, thus improving rider comfort
Protection:
- New synthetic microfiber panel on medial side for enhanced abrasion resistance and improved feeling when in contact with the bike
- New TPU shifter for increased protection on lower medial side
- Inner bootie is equipped with a new external toe area with a soft TPU reinforcement for superior impact protection and additional ankle padding for greater protection and stability during natural movement of the foot
- CE EN13634:2017
- Replaceable co-injected TPU/aluminum toe slider with an easy screw system that protects the toe area against abrasion resistance
- New replaceable heel plate slider design offers increased sliding performance and protection in the case of crash

Purchased these as a new rider after trying to Sidi Mag 1 shoes and not loving them. The Supertech R boots are far superior, but with a few notes.
As the shoe contains an inner shoe with the rigid armor and then the outer boot with the leather, they make your feet longer and this will impact your feel on the pegs. The heel is taller than a normal shoe, and the sole is stiff, all of this means your thighs will be a little more tight/higher when sitting with the balls of your feet or sometimes, lazy heels, on the pegs.
The fit is spot on, not big or small, to size. The inner boot contains stretchy fabric you sinch up when putting them on, so wide or narrow feet should all fit. If you have really thick calves, you might need some strength to close the outside boot until worn in.
They fit fine with jeans, suit or sweatpants if you are buying them for your IG clout.
They are however very HOT. Vented, sure, but on a 30c day in Vancouver if I wasn't moving my feet were an absolute sweat bath. The heat radiating up my legs and acting as a heater for the inner thigh and chaps. Absolute FURNACE, but, they are not meant for sitting in Earls patios or a stroll on the beach, my callout here is please consider some light and breathable socks with them. The shoes are comfy, the liner and heel offer good comfort considering it's a racing boot, but wear some thin socks or pay the price.
If you want comfort, look at the "Faster 4" boots. Those can be used every day. If you want maximum protection and a shoe you can take to the track, the twisty's or post on your IG, this is it.
Please note, took about 20 hours of wear for them to feel comfortable. 40 hours in they feel good now, but still stiff.
